Turkish singer Haluk Levent has been arrested as part of an investigation involving the "Ahbap" charity, which he founded.
Axar.az reports, citing Turkish media, that 14 people, including lawyer Ece Guner, who was detained alongside Levent, were remanded in custody by a court.
Levent, founder of the "Ahbap" association, came into the public spotlight following the February 6 earthquakes for the organization's relief efforts and fundraising campaigns. Authorities have since raised various allegations regarding the use of donations, certain financial transfers, and other transactions linked to the charity.
He faces charges of violating the law on associations, money laundering, and membership in a criminal organization.
